When you visit a blog, you often see excerpts of articles first. Download free 30-day trial. I just fixed it. I misspelled in the examlpe it is @Object. I actually need this to happen on a
The onclick JavaScript event occurs when the user clicks on an element. Neither does it help us save the world. Then we'll see how the more modern "click" eventListner works, which lets you separate the HTML from the JavaScript. Then you can click on a "read more" button to show the rest. If you click the Save button, submit parameter will be Save. Is there a trick for softening butter quickly? - so it is @ModelObjectA. The function we want to execute is showMore(), which we will write soon. Find centralized, trusted content and collaborate around the technologies you use most. button click mvc in view. The element to be clicked first selected and the click () method is used. Firstly, according to your description, the selected tab index and selected date should be passed to DelayedSpiffDate() action method as parameters, but your DelayedSpiffDate() method just accepts only one parameter. 3. Our mission: to help people learn to code for free. HTML button calling an MVC view and Action method. The below code does that. Just below is the form I submit on the button clicks. So we set a bottom margin of 16 pixels in order to separate them from one another. Yes I saw that. The HTML Anchor Link element has been assigned a Click event handler which makes call to the CallButtonEvent JavaScript function. What value for LANG should I use for "sort -u correctly handle Chinese characters? Code Review Stack Exchange is a question and answer site for peer programmer code reviews. 4. How can we create psychedelic experiences for healthy people without drugs? I am tying it but my button click is not going to method which i written in control. Let's try to do that. I am open for suggestions. In JavaScript, there are multiple ways of doing the same thing. Find centralized, trusted content and collaborate around the technologies you use most.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. The best answers are voted up and rise to the top, Not the answer you're looking for? It is hard to understand why you are passing an button type parameter to this function. To fix this, we set overflow to hidden in order not to show that text at first.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S, Correct handling of negative chapter numbers. Asking for help, clarification, or responding to other answers. Here is what I am describing. In this tutorial, we are going to explore the two different ways of executing click events in JavaScript using two different methods. rev2022.11.3.43003. First of, read my rant on MVC: http://www.sitepoint.com/mvc-problem-solution/. Hi Fei Han. The inner function will be returned on each iteration and attached to the click event with the index value. Here is the case: Now, about in the function getting image src by id using JavaScript document.getElementById(). I'm really new to ASP.NET MVC but a way that I solved this was that I had a couple of buttons on my form and gave each of them a class, and then specified the data parameters for them, in this example I've got two properties from some item Val1 and Val2 for the first button and two for the second - Val1 and Val3: Due to the max height of the article element, all the text won't be contained and will overflow. I have request to navigate to ShowAllModelObjectA. To learn more, see our tips on writing great answers. Model HashKey - containing 1 string key. It allows the programmer to execute a JavaScript's function when an element gets clicked. We use an ifelse statement here. the user enters a date into the datepicker, clicks submit, and then based on which tab is selected, a function will be run. Are cheap electric helicopters feasible to produce? http://stackoverflow.com/questions/9412362/pass-parameter-from-view-to-controller-razor, http://www.codecompiled.com/using-jquery-get-and-post-ajax-methods-in-mvc/. Almost always javascript will successfully execute before the form submits (depending how fast the javascript at hand can run). Maybe, maybe not. Does the 0m elevation height of a Digital Elevation Model (Copernicus DEM) correspond to mean sea level? Above is the syntax mostly used in JavaScript Frameworks like ReactJs, AngularJs, etc. rev2022.11.3.43003. What I have written works and am looking for more understanding when it comes to events fired from javascript vs events fired to an MVC Action. I have a search criteria and button.Bbased on search criteria after submit a button i want to display a grid in MVC.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. as scroll through display more data in react app. Can a character use 'Paragon Surge' to gain a feat they temporarily qualify for? Is there a way to make trades similar/identical to a university endowment manager to copy them? EDIT 2: I am not sure what i need to use to fulfill that requirement. This is a crucial part of JavaScript that helps you make decisions in your code if a certain condition is met. So, inside our function, we take the name variable we declared to get our freeCodeCamp text, then we change the color to blue. Our selector, article.open, has a property of max-height set to 1000px. Thanks for contributing an answer to Stack Overflow! 2. What I have written works and am looking for more understanding when it comes to events fired from javascript vs events fired to an MVC Action. I'm a bit lost with implementing MCV pattern on javascript. How can I find a lens locking screw if I have lost the original one? The controller call the class A with the object to transfer and sends the unique key to the ShowAllModelObjectA. Communication between View and Controller in MVC implementation, Angular wrapper for SignalR event aggregator, My take on implementing the Repository Design Pattern in PHP, Vanilla JavaScript ToDo List implementation. If you click on Cancel button the submit parameter will have value of Cancel. Finding features that intersect QgsRectangle but are not equal to themselves using PyQGIS. Figure 1. How can I get a huge Saturn-like ringed moon in the sky? Does activating the pump in a vacuum chamber produce movement of the air inside? First of all, we need to select the element we want to manipulate, which is the freeCodeCamp text inside the tag. HTML5 formaction and formmethod attributes make a dropdown in react where first option comes from backend. We need to select our article first, because we have to show the rest of it: The next thing we need to do is write the function showMore() so we can toggle between seeing the rest of the article and hiding it. calling one method from another in python. So then, added an if the condition for change image onclick event. In HTML: <element onclick="myScript"> Finally, we used the hover pseudo-class in CSS to change the button cursor to a pointer. .net mvc button onclick call action. Stack Overflow for Teams is moving to its own domain! This is a data structure representing the page as a series of nodes and objects. And that will do the magic! Events have nothing to do with MVC. Can any one please suggest how to write button click event in MVC. Sandeep Mewara. Its simple HTML with some facts about freeCodeCamp. The second link you provided is broken. An inf-sup estimate for holomorphic functions, Water leaving the house when water cut off. Although, that makes sense. Finally, when you click on the Button, the click event is triggered and redirected to the corresponding method in a specified controller. To learn more, see our tips on writing great answers. Controller ControllerModelObjectA - serve as as pure controller. And here is my controller if it is needed: Any ideas on how to make this happen on a button click? How to set variable when button is clicked using Razor? At any given time, each controller has one associated view and model, although one model object may hear from many different controllers. In this article, you learned how to fix the issue that arises when you attach click events inside for loop in a few ways. I have a Bootstrap navtab panel that when the tabs are clicked, based on which tab is clicked it runs an MVC C# function in my controller. MathJax reference. I
Try something like this: Thanks for contributing an answer to Stack Overflow! location.href = '@Url.Action ("Index","Home")'; } In the Url.Action you can specify the Controller name and the Action name. where you add notifiers and listeners: Or some other approach. You can make a tax-deductible donation here. Solution. I tried the following. JavaScript Event Listeners are divided into 2 types, i.e., Interactive and Non Interactive Event Handlers, But i can try. Model ModelObjectA - my object to transport. On each object`s button i have to use a @functions to call ClassA and send the object itself, but ONLY on click not on for loop. Why does it matter that a group of January 6 rioters went to Olive Garden for dinner after the riot? And here's the CSS to make it look good, along with all the rest of the example code: So, on the web page, this is what we have: Our aim is to change the color of the text to blue when we click the button. Now, add function in the button tag which is name imagefun with onclick() event. Our code is working fine with a smooth transition: We can separate the HTML and JavaScript and still use onclick, because onclick is JavaScript. I do get the correct value for correctid, but it's not running code in the conditional statement. Then you store the value in a variable. Write a ButtonClick event handler to implement additional client-side functionality when a user clicks a button within a button editor. Because we removed the default margin, our paragraphs got all pushed together. For what I can see you are assigning the object itself to "value", you should assign some property of the object. This event can be used for validating a form, warning messages and many more. Along with the object in the table is putted also 3 buttons that represents different functions (View details, edit, delete) to corresponding object. ASP.NET Theme Builder ASP.NET Theme Deployer Maintenance Mode. The JavaScript onclick event executes a function when you click on a button or another web element. Now that we have the text selected, let's write our function. New to Telerik UI for ASP.NET MVC? Example - subscribe to the "click" event during initialization Note that the onclick attribute is purely JavaScript. If I had more complicated JS going on maybe I should use the preventDefault method. Math papers where the only issue is that someone else could've done it but didn't, Non-anthropic, universal units of time for active SETI. easiest way to have the enter key submit a form with create react app. The JavaScript function AlertName () takes a input parameter name to pass the employee name . Telerik UI for ASP.NET MVC. The javascript I have sets a value true or false based on the button that is pressed. MVC is only server side. Remarks. In this tutorial, I will be using querySelector() because it is more modern and it's faster. View ShowAllModelObjectA - view page to display the collection from controller. Representing the page in a DOM makes it easier for programs to interact with and manipulate the page.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site, Learn more about Stack Overflow the company, http://www.sitepoint.com/mvc-problem-solution/,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ned, Ajax plugin that binds to click and page load. on button click call controller action mvc. As a result, when the button is clicked, the . If you really want to ensure javascript runs before the form is submitted, you need to use a method like this: You got it wrong, there is no MVC once your browser gets the response from server. console tab. The onclick event is a DOM event that occurs when a user clicks on an element. Where to call _gaq.push Google Analyticss in MVC form? So we need to write it in a JavaScript file, or in the HTML file inside a